Like violence in general, it depends on how it's portrayed. We (collectively) enjoy seeing action movies heroes mow down armies of mooks and inflict violence on others, because there's a theatrical component that's obvious by context. At the same time, violence in something like Game of Thrones or something even more dramatic isn't meant to appeal to that same feeling of base enjoyment. Mostly the difference is in how realistically it's portrayed.

If you thought the scene in Watchmen, or something like Irreversible was hot, that's deeply concerning. If you read a more "cinematic" smutty rape scene that was meant to appeal to prurient interests, or play that out in a roleplaying context, it's different. It goes back to rational adults being able to separate reality from fantasy, and understand that fantasizing about things in a safe manner doesn't condone them in real life.

So in terms of RPGs to address the OP question, it depends on the tone. But by default, it's not something I'd ever bring up without knowing the players well, and never in an explicit sense outside of some pre-agreed on ERP scenario. For the vast majority of normal games, it shouldn't come up. In a darker tone, mentioning it makes sense to establish tone, but that should be done carefully. It should never arbitrarily be a consequence for PCs.
